What Is Rod Wave’s Net Worth?

With a net worth estimated at $4 million, Rod Wave is an American rapper, singer, and songwriter renowned for his powerful voice and significant contributions to the soul-trap genre. His impact was felt with the release of his initial studio albums, “Ghetto Gospel” (2019) and “Pray 4 Love” (2020), both of which achieved top 10 positions on the “Billboard” 200 chart. His deeply emotional lyrics, often highlighting his battles with mental health, hardships of poverty, and the stark truths of street life, strike a chord with his audience. “Heart on Ice,” his breakout single, exemplifies his talent for merging heartfelt lyrics with melodious sounds. His unique vocal style and fervent performances distinguish him within the modern rap landscape. In 2021, his third studio album, “SoulFly,” debuted at the top of the “Billboard” 200, further establishing his prominence in the music realm.

Early Life

Rod Wave, born Rodarius Marcell Green on August 27, 1999, in St. Petersburg, Florida, experienced parental separation during his elementary school years, leading to his mother’s primary influence in his upbringing. His father was engaged in illicit activities and faced over five years of imprisonment while Wave was still young. Facing economic difficulties, his mother struggled, which influenced Rod to partake in robbery and drug dealing as a teen. Graduating from Lakewood High School in 2017, he developed a passion for rap and hip-hop, citing influences from artists such as E-40, Chingy, Boosie Badazz, Chief Keef, Kanye West, and Kevin Gates.

Career

Rod Wave kicked off his music career in 2016 with the mixtape, “Hunger Games Vol. 1.” Following this, he released several independent mixtapes until he signed with Alamo Records. In June 2019, he dropped the mixtape “PTSD,” featuring the hit “Heart on Ice,” which became a sensation on platforms like YouTube and TikTok, climbing to the 25th position on the “Billboard” Hot 100.

Shortly after, he launched his debut album, “Ghetto Gospel,” which peaked at #10 on the U.S. “Billboard” 200. He proceeded to create his second album, “Pray 4 Love,” which was released in April 2020 and debuted at #2 on the “Billboard” 200. In August of that same year, he released a deluxe edition of the album. Multiple tracks from this album made their way onto the “Billboard” Hot 100. That month, he was also recognized as part of the “XXL” 2020 Freshman Class, highlighting emerging talent in hip-hop.

Much of 2020 saw Wave devoted to his third album’s production. In March 2021, he announced the album’s title, “SoulFly,” alongside its track list, releasing it shortly thereafter. The track “Tombstone” reached its peak at #11 on the Hot 100, marking his highest-charting single. During the 2021 Billboard Music Awards, he was honored with the Top New Artist Award.

In January 2022, Wave put out the single “Cold December.” By May of that year, he had released a freestyle over Future’s “Wait for U,” during which he announced that his fourth album would be titled “Beautiful Mind.” Released in August 2022, he subsequently embarked on a two-month tour, supported by artists Toosi and Mariah the Scientist. In mid-November, he shared an extended play “Jupiter’s Diary: 7 Day Theory,” featuring the song “Break My Heart,” which secured the #76 position on the charts.

Personal Life

Rod Wave is currently in a relationship with Kelsey, and together they welcomed twin daughters, reportedly named Kash and Mocha Green. He prefers to keep his personal and family affairs private, refraining from sharing details on his social media platforms.
